WineAddicts_RN74 Likes this wine: 93 points
March 19, 2023 - Needs patience to journey through this wine. Once popped, nose is floral, beautiful, but palate is a 180degree different with high acidity & tightness. Poured 1/3 bottle into decanter while drinking the other portion in large Grand Cru burg glasses. After 3 hr aeration in glasses, body grows bigger, with darker cherries, sweet berries, ripe raspberries, hints of liquorice, sweet spices and Visible OAKS, so much fruits, oak, ripeness, I guessed it was a 2009, i also find it new world in style at this stage too. The decanted portion (5hr in decanter) put you in a different planet - where Grip has turned velvety, all harshness, astringency disappear…as if inside a peaceful botanical garden, surrounded by intoxicating bouquets of roses, violets, flowers, also with Redder cherries, raspberries, berries fruits, earth & Vosne spices…where all the elements come together so harmoniously & well balanced. A beautiful journey.
